Friendship Quote by Robin Sacredfire
““People only value what they can't have and what they've lost. This applies to friends too. Before anyone became famous, he was a normal person as well. But during this time he didn't have as many admirers and followers. That's a great paradox in life, for we are always alone in our path towards success, but never alone when we don't need anyone any longer.””
